I’ve Elementor pro and woocommerce installed and I’ve changed the woocommerce order received endpoint to a custom one to use my custom thank you page but the old woocommerce page still show.
If I understand this correctly, you matched the thank-you page endpoint with a slug of a custom-created page.
Sorry to disappoint, but the order received page doesn’t work like this. You’ll need a custom PHP snippet or plugin to have that Elementor page as a custom “thank you” page.
